In order to lower the risk of liquid explosives, there are strict rules about how much liquids and similar substances people can bring in their carry-on bags.

 

Liquids can only be brought in packages that are 100 milliliters or less in size and must be sealed in a clear bag. In addition, each traveler can only bring one liter of liquid with them.
